Industry Analysis
At 3nm and below, testing has evolved from a yield gatekeeper to the central nervous system of manufacturing. The bottleneck in 'smart test' isn't algorithmic—it's fractured data chains. With wafer probing, packaging, and burn-in relying on disparate tools lacking unified semantics or device identity, ML models risk catastrophic misjudgment. While TSMC and NVIDIA push adaptive flows, without integrating parametric and thermal telemetry from PDF Solutions or proteanTecs, sub-second decisions remain elusive. Geopolitical export controls are forcing supply chain reconfiguration; vendors like Advantest or Nordson that withhold open data interfaces risk exclusion from advanced packaging ecosystems. Within 18 months, a 'data trust premium' will emerge: only test infrastructure providers offering end-to-end traceability will command pricing power, while point-tool vendors face commoditization.
